Arslan “Ash” Siddiqui, a legendary figure in Pakistani esports, won the “Jemputan Tekken 7 Championship” in Sepang, Malaysia on Sunday, adding yet another accolade to his illustrious career.

The Tekken 7 veteran was first defeated 2-0 by Kkokkoma in winners round 2, but he rallied well to defeat LowHigh’s Shaheen 3-1 in the grand final with his Kunimitsu.

Siddiqui defeated Galgonge of South Korea 3-0 in the championship match to win the Uprising Korea 2023 competition last week.

He won the title in Las Vegas in August of this year, making history as a four-time EVO champion.

The only person in the world to win Tekken 7’s coveted tournament four times is Siddiqui. He won the championship in both Japan and Las Vegas in 2019 and did it again this year.

He was crowned the “best E-Player of 2019” by sports media and is widely regarded as the greatest Tekken player of all time.

He also won the “2022 combo Breaker Tekken 7” tournament after dominating all 10 of his opponents, as well as the “CEO 2021 champion” competition.
